Serving 697 students in grades Prekindergarten-6, Max O Vaughan Elementary School ranks in the top 10% of all schools in Texas for overall test scores (math proficiency is top 10%, and reading proficiency is top 10%) .
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 62% (which is higher than the Texas state average of 37%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 65% (which is higher than the Texas state average of 42%).
The student:teacher ratio of 17:1 is higher than the Texas state level of 14:1.
Minority enrollment is 60% of the student body (majority Asian and Hispanic), which is lower than the Texas state average of 74% (majority Hispanic).

Max O Vaughan Elementary School's student population of 697 students has stayed relatively flat over five school years.
The teacher population of 41 teachers has declined by 8% over five school years.

Max O Vaughan Elementary School ranks within the top 10% of all 8,079 schools in Texas (based off of combined math and reading proficiency testing data).
The diversity score of Max O Vaughan Elementary School is 0.74, which is more than the diversity score at state average of 0.64. The school's diversity has stayed relatively flat over five school years.
